Buying Guide

  • Arc pattern and coverage: Choose spray heads with adjustable arcs (0–360 degrees) to fit irregular bed shapes and edge lines. 180° or 180/360° options provide targeted watering for narrow strips or full-circle zones.
  • Spray distance and precipitation: Look for heads with a spray distance up to 15 feet for residential lawns. Matched precipitation helps ensure uniform moisture across zones when used with compatible controllers and irrigation schedules.
  • Inlet and compatibility: Confirm inlet size (commonly 1/2 inch NPT) to fit your existing risers. Ensure compatibility with your irrigation system’s pressure and compatibility with Rain Bird, Hunter, or other brands if mixing components.
  • Head height and soil conditions: 4″ and 6″ pop-up heads are suitable for varying grass heights and soil conditions. Taller heads appear cleaner in high-grade landscapes but require deeper installation.
  • Durability and maintenance: Look for leak-resistive designs, corrosion-resistant materials, and easy-to-clean components. Flush caps and debris guards help prevent clogging in sandy or clay soils.
  • Drip versus spray heads: Sprinkler spray heads are best for lawns and beds with wider coverage needs, while micro spray emitters and stakes are ideal for precise drip irrigation around individual plants or rows.
  • Installation and scale: For larger properties, consider bundles (packs) to streamline replacement and installation. Ensure you have compatible tubing, risers, and clamps for a cohesive system.
